For Sale by Original Owner - 1966 Triumph Spitfire MK2
Car has 36,000 miles with a current PA inspection. Rewired and repainted in original Racing Blue. Wire wheels, Vredestein sport tires and new front disc brakes. Oil pressure gauge and temperature sensing gauge are mounted on the instrument cluster matching the wooden dash. Seats are the original style blue upholstery. Included are the original white tonneau cover and a black canvas soft top. The car has been kept in the garage and is in excellent condition.
Hagerty Insider describes this model as “the last version of the car to retain Michelotti’s original and very pretty design…generally missing are splash shield / valence boards…if you can find one you have a unicorn on your hands”.
This is that car.
